
コマンドライン ジャンキーとして、私は LIST から PC-Write 3.02 (ワードラップ、ボックス モード処理、その他のいくつかのトリックを備えたテキスト エディターとして使用)、QBASIC (非常に迅速な 1 回限りのプログラムに最適) など、さまざまなツールを日常的に使用しています。コンソール ユーティリティには明確な制限がありますが、ファイルを表示してビューアを終了するときにコマンドラインに戻れるのは便利です (その間に他のウィンドウを使用していたとしても)。これらの機能はエミュレータなしでは Windows 7 では動作しないため、最適な方法は何でしょうか。コマンドライン ウィンドウ内で実行できる他のユーティリティをお勧めしますか。または、それらを起動したコマンドライン ウィンドウ内で実行できるエミュレータはありますか (できれば、「DOS はサポートされなくなりました」というメッセージの代わりに挿入してください)。皆さんはどのようなものをお勧めですか。
答え1
GNUWin32と同様に、シグウィン- Windows 用の Linux アプリ (ほとんどがコマンドライン)。
答え2
使用しないcmd.exe
、使用するパワーシェル。
より強力で、より一貫性があり、.NET、COM、WMI に直接アクセスできます。リモート処理が含まれています。Win7/2008R2 ではデフォルトでインストールされ、サポートされている以前のバージョンでも使用できます。
最も良い点: コマンド間のテキスト パイプラインをオブジェクト パイプラインに置き換えます (数値、日付などを解析および再解析する必要はありません。型は保持されます)。
ほとんどのアプリケーション (コマンド ラインまたはウィンドウ) は、PowerShell 内から実行されます ( の場合と同様cmd.exe
)。
答え3
21世紀になってもこの疑問が問われているのは驚くべきことだ。「パワーユーティリティ」MS/PC/DR-DOSユーザーの大半は、1990年代からWin32と同等かそれ以上のものを使っている。実際、それはかなり昔のことなので、ウィンドウズTUI ツールは、時代遅れになってきました。現在も残っているツールを少し紹介します。
- マイクロソフト独自のUNIX ベース アプリケーション用サブシステムWindows 7 UltimateエディションおよびWindows Server 2008 R2に同梱されており、ダウンロード可能なSFUAユーティリティツールキット(Windows XPの場合は、ダウンロードインストールするUNIX バージョン 3.5 のサービス
mv
このツールキットには、やからdu
、Korn シェルや C シェル、 や に至るまでperl
、多数のコマンドライン TUI ツールが含まれており、awk
x86-64 と IA64 の両方のバージョンと、x86-32 のバージョンが用意されています。 - JPソフトウェアのTCC/LE内蔵されているLISTコマンド他にも多数あります。
- いくつかのTUIオーソドックスなファイルマネージャ、以下を含むWindows 用ファイルコマンダーそして遠い、まだ存在します。
- のSysInternals スイート
ListDLLs
やなどのシステムタスク用の TUI ツールがいくつか含まれていますLDMDump
。
のWindows Server 2003 リソース キット ツール、これには別のLIST プログラムは、その後廃止された Windows TUI ツールの例です。Windows 7 に相当するものはありません。
答え4
andLinux をインストールしてみるのもよいでしょう:http://www.andlinux.org/多くの GNU およびコマンドラインおよび Linux ツールにアクセスします。